Question
We are getting married in our local village church. We have seen the vicar once to talk about what we need to do but nothing was mentioned about getting the marriage licence. Do we have to go to the register office for this?
Answer
If you're marrying in a church, you don't need to visit a register office. All the paper work is done for you by your vicar. The only thing you will need to do is attend the church for the reading of the banns but your vicar will explain this to you.
